WebLike all meat products, whether raw or cooked, chicken will quickly go bad if left at room temperature. There are two reasons for this: Temperature. At temperatures of just 40°F and above, bacteria and microorganisms will start to multiply up to 5 times faster. WebPerishable (whether it is raw or cooked) meats and poultry in vacuum packaging cannot be stored at room temperature. They must be kept either in the refrigerator at 40 ºF or below, or for longer storage, in the freezer at 0 °F or below. WebFreeze fresh chicken as soon as possible to maintain the best quality. Store frozen chicken in a freezer unit to obtain maximum storage time. Thaw frozen chicken using one of three methods: in the refrigerator; in cold water, changing every 30 minutes; or in the microwave. NEVER thaw chicken at room temperature. WebMay 25, 2024 · The U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) food and safety basics states cooked food can be left at room temperature up to two hours. If the temperature outside (or inside your house) is 90 ° F or above, you should cut that time in half. When the temperature of cooked food is between 40°F and 140°F the USDA considers that the “Danger Zone ... Webweight from 4 to 22 pounds at temperatures of 55, 70, and 84F (12.8, 21.1, and 28.9C). These authors concluded that ambient (room) air temperature thawing, at 70F and below, is a satisfactory thawing procedure. It takes about 15 hours for the middle of a 22-pound turkey to get to 32F, while the surface temperature rises to 53F or less.
